Subject: Quickstore 4.2 — bloom filter now fronts the KV layer

Plugin authors: starting with this release, Quickstore places a bloom filter ahead of the key-value store. Negative lookups return faster; false positives fall through safely. No API changes are required on your side. Verify your plugin against the staging build referenced below.

session token of fahif-tadup = htk3_9c7

Welcome to the Pixelwash support rotation at Larkfield Systems. Pixelwash strips EXIF metadata from every customer-uploaded image before storage, so never assume location or device data survives ingestion. When reproducing a scrub failure, always pull the quarantined original through the audit console, not the CDN. Verified builds of the scrubber are signed, and support tooling checks each build against the key below.

release key, tajep-tahaf: bky19_d9NV5NtNvNNQVVKBK4P

## Runbook 4.3 — Dependency pinning & release signing

Policy: every dependency in the Bramblecart manifest is pinned to an exact version. No ranges, no wildcards. Contractors may not bump pins without a ticket approved by the platform lead. After any pin change, regenerate the lockfile, run the full audit pass, and rebuild from a clean workspace. Unsigned builds are rejected by the promoter, no exceptions. Once the audit is green, sign the artifact on the release host with the key below.

rollout seal: bky4_DFM9